
This comparison is for buyers choosing between a wireless TKL keyboard and a wired 75% keyboard with a knob. The decision is difficult because both boards support QMK and VIA, offer hot-swappable switches, and come from the same brand. The K8 Max brings 2.4 GHz and Bluetooth connectivity, while the Q1 has a full aluminum case and a double-gasket mount for a different typing feel.

If you need a wireless keyboard for travel or a clutter-free desk, the K8 Max is the clear choice with its Bluetooth, 2.4 GHz, and long battery life. If you prefer a compact layout, a gasket mount feel, and the flexibility of a barebones build or a knob, the Q1 delivers a more premium wired experience. Your decision should hinge on whether wireless freedom or mechanical customizability matters more for your setup.
The K8 Max wins in gaming and travel due to its wireless options, lighter weight, and 4000mAh battery. The Q1 takes the lead in programming and modding thanks to its gasket mount, compact 75% layout, programmable knob, and barebones availability. Office and content creation tasks are equally well served by either board, since both share QMK and VIA support, sound dampening, and cross-platform keycaps.
